IFEC and The J.M. Smucker Company Announce the Third Annual Food for Good Award

Pleasant Valley, NY – The International Foodservice Editorial Council (IFEC), in partnership with The J.M. Smucker Company’s Away From Home division, are pleased to announce that nominations are now being accepted for the Food for Good Award, which honors nonprofit organizations whose work with food is making significant contributions to improving lives in the communities they serve. IFEC and Smucker Away From Home will present the third annual Food for Good Award to an organization in the Raleigh, Durham and Chapel Hill area (The Triangle) during IFEC’s conference, October 24 - 26, 2018.  

Smucker Away From Home was the inaugural sponsor of the awards in 2016 and continues its partnership with IFEC to recognize and celebrate the work a deserving organization is doing to transform The Triangle community through food. The J.M. Smucker Company is committed to actively supporting the communities it serves.

The intention behind the award is first and foremost to honor those who are performing good works through food, while at the same time encouraging others to use the nurturing powers of food not only for good health – as fundamental as that is – but also for empowering people and their communities.

“IFEC is proud to partner with Smucker Away From Home to honor nonprofit organizations focused on using food for good,” says Tom O’Brien, president of IFEC. “There are so many terrific organizations making a difference and this is our way to let them know we stand with them and appreciate all they are doing to improve the overall quality of the communities they serve.”

Nominations & Qualifications
Members and friends of IFEC are invited to nominate candidates for the 2018 Food for Good Award using the official nominations form available on the IFEC site, www.ifeconline.com, or by request to ifec@ifeconline.com.  Nominations will be accepted through August 31, 2018.

Nonprofit organizations, including public schools, that are based in or operating in The Triangle area and are making notable contributions toward at least one of the following goals are eligible.

  • Help underserved community members gain access to quality food

  • Connect and empower community members through food

  • Sustain crucial elements of the community’s food culture

  • Provide or facilitate training and/or jobs in foodservice to underserved populations

  • Assist children, the elderly and other vulnerable populations in learning to make smart food choices

The recipient will be selected by a panel of judges chaired by IFEC Member, Amber Hensley, public relations director, Marlin Network. Other judges include Liz Anderson, senior public relations manager, Firehouse Subs; Mary Humann, owner of The Humann Factor, Loree Dowse, director of creative marketing, Mann’s Fresh Vegetables; Molly Erickson, public relations manager, Marlin Network and Kristen Baughman, founder, Tabletop Media Group.

About IFEC
IFEC is the membership association for editors, public relations and marketing communications professionals working within and with the foodservice business-to-business media. IFEC’s objective is to sponsor educational and other programs to heighten the overall quality of foodservice communications and encourage the entry of high-caliber individuals into the field.

About Smucker Away From Home
Founded in 1897, The J.M. Smucker Company has been committed to offering consumers quality products that help bring families together to share memorable meals and moments - at home or away from home.

The Company remains rooted in the Basic Beliefs of Quality, People, Ethics, Growth and Independence established by its founder and namesake more than a century ago.

Smucker Away From Home is a division of The J.M. Smucker Company and specializes in meeting the needs of foodservice professionals. A wide range of quality products are offered through its family of iconic brands, which include Smucker's®, Dickinson's®, Jif®, Folgers®, Sahale Snacks®, Sugar In The Raw®, Sweet’n Low® and Café Bustelo®.
